Java Program to Convert Octal Number to Decimal and vice-versa
In this program, you’ll learn to convert octal number to a decimal number and vice-versa using functions in Java.
Example 1: Program to Convert Decimal to Octal
public class DecimalOctal{
public static void main(String[] args){
int decimal = 78;
int octal = convertDecimalToOctal(decimal);
System.out.printf("%d in decimal = %d in octal", decimal, octal);
}
public static int convertDecimalToOctal(int decimal){
int octalNumber = 0, i = 1;
while (decimal != 0)
{
octalNumber += (decimal % 8) * i;
decimal /= 8;
i *= 10;
}
return octalNumber;
}
}
Output
78 in decimal = 116 in octal
This conversion takes place as:
8 | 78 8 | 9 -- 6 8 | 1 -- 1 8 | 0 -- 1 (116)
Example 2: Program to Convert Octal to Decimal
public class OctalDecimal{
public static void main(String[] args){
int octal = 116;
int decimal = convertOctalToDecimal(octal);
System.out.printf("%d in octal = %d in decimal", octal, decimal);
}
public static int convertOctalToDecimal(int octal){
int decimalNumber = 0, i = 0;
while(octal != 0)
{
decimalNumber += (octal % 10) * Math.pow(8, i);
++i;
octal/=10;
}
return decimalNumber;
}
}
Output
116 in octal = 78 in decimal
This conversion takes place as:
1 * 82 + 1 * 81 + 6 * 80 = 78

Two Machine Learning Fields
There are two sides to machine learning:
- Practical Machine Learning:This is about querying databases, cleaning data, writing scripts to transform data and gluing algorithm and libraries together and writing custom code to squeeze reliable answers from data to satisfy difficult and ill defined questions. It’s the mess of reality.
- Theoretical Machine Learning: This is about math and abstraction and idealized scenarios and limits and beauty and informing what is possible. It is a whole lot neater and cleaner and removed from the mess of reality.
